NGC 5353 - galaxy in the constellation Canum Venaticorum Type: S0 - lenticular galaxy The angular dimensions: 2.20'x1.1' magnitude: V=11.0m; B=12.0m The surface brightness: 11.8 mag/arcmin2 Coordinates for epoch J2000: Ra= 13h53m26.7s; Dec= 40°16'59" redshift (z): 0.007755 The distance from the Sun to NGC 5353: based on the amount of redshift (z) - 32.8 Mpc; Other names of the object NGC 5353 : PGC 49356, UGC 8813, MCG 7-29-10, CGCG 219-18, HCG 68A
